Job Description

We are seeking a Project Manager/Federal Budget Analyst to join our growing team. The candidate will lead a team of Business Analysts for the VA while providing business, financial, and technical-advisory support for the Information Technology Account Managers.
Roles/Responsibilities:
Oversee a Portfolio Team operations and personnel to ensure smooth and productive interactions with government staff and fulfillment of government deliverables
Act in an advisory capacity to IT BIOS staff in regard to IT, budget, and business process analysis
Orchestrate and assist in the intake of new technical requests from business partners
Determine areas of improvement for Business Processes and present improved business plans and workflows to government staff
Analyze Excel budget plans ranging from a one-year perspective to multi-year plans to provide advisory input regarding the allocation of Benefits funding
Provide support to government staff in both planning and hosting working groups, planning sessions, weekly meetings, and conferences
Perform high-level reviews of technical projects to provide analysis and areas of improvement

Skills & Qualifications:
Experience and deep understanding of CPIC and PPBE
Ability to understand, edit, and as-needed create both Multi-Year and Single-Year Budget Operating Plans in the form of Excel spreadsheets
Ability to pivot with changing demands
Ability to grasp senior leadership concepts and establish follow-up action steps
Comprehend technical systems and terminology such as APIs, RPA, and Enterprise Applications
Communication skills allowing for both cooperative communication and conflict resolution with government staff and coworkers from a wide array of backgrounds and positions
Expert with the Microsoft Office suite of products (Microsoft Word, Excel, Visio, PowerPoint, Teams and SharePoint)
High degree of leadership and management proficiency
High level of competency in creating organized and aesthetically appealing Microsoft PowerPoint presentations
Other Requirements:
Master's Degree in Engineering, Computer Science, Systems, Business or related scientific/technical discipline
15 years of experience, with 5+ years of experience in federal acquisition support
VA experience a plus (especially within OIT)
Must have excellent analytical skills
Exceptional organizational skills, attention to detail, and ability to work under tight deadlines
Competent communication skills and ability to interact with a diverse range of business partners
Familiarity with government budget planning and financial spreadsheets
